-
Download CodeIgniter from CodeIgniter.com
-
Extract CodeIgniter to your web root
-
Install Illuminate Database package
composer require illuminate/database
-
Install Illuminate Events package
composer require illuminate/events
-
Add next lines to "composer.json" file
... "autoload": { "classmap": [ "application/core", "application/models", "application/libraries" ] } ...
-
Add next line to /index.php
... include_once('vendor/autoload.php'); ...
-
Copy "elo.php" to /application/libraries
-
Adjust eloquent database(s) config on /application/libraries/elo.php
-
Load eloquent library from /application/config/autoload.php
... $autoload['libraries'] = array('elo', 'database'); ...
-
Copy "My_Model.php" to /application/core
-
Create new CI Model extend to My_Model
-
Create new CI Controller
-
Do composer update to mapping class, etc
composer update
-
Test & Debug.
-
Done. :)
iruwl / ci3_eloquent Goto Github PK
View Code? Open in Web Editor NEWCodeIgniter 3.0.6 With Eloquent ORM
License: MIT License